Minutes of the
Norwich Recreation Advisory Board
January 19, 2022
Call to Order 6:03pm.
Meeting held by Zoom. Present: Jeff Blinderman, Derell Wilson, Julie Cagle, Cheryl Hancin, Tara Booker, Grant
Neurendorf.
Minutes of the Sept 15, 2021 were approved.
New Business
Cheryl gave a facility update. The crew was working on leaves, brush removal, repairing park facility, painting signs, plowing
working on building issues. They are working on getting quote to repair announcer booth and dug out roofs at several
fields. She reviewed the status of the Armstrong tennis courts. The tennis committee has been working on getting
estimates and quotes to resurface the tennis courts. Due to Covid‐19 constructions costs are up and more funding may be
needed than initially planned. Julie asked if more donors could be found including funding from NFA.
Ad Hoc tennis committee renewal and possible appointment.
The tennis committee asked to be extended another 2 years. Due to covid‐19, the fundraising efforts have been slow and
the project is not complete. The City Council has it on an upcoming agenda to extend the committee. A member of the
committee just resigned and that vacancy will be posted soon also.
Program update
Fall Session 2 programs are doing great. Waitlists for many such as Karate, tumbling, basketball, dance and pre‐school
programs Winter session started early and enrollments are strong. Our annual basketball league is going well, the junior
division is full with a wait list. The Sr. Division has a few spots open. We collaborated with NPS Athletic Director Lou Allen on
the Sr. division and moved the program to Saturdays to attract more youth. The high school league had low attendance so
we are running it as an open rec night for high schoolers instead so that they can still play basketball this Winter. It is open
to new registrations. We are following all Dept. of Health Covid‐19 guidelines in all programs.
Budget Update: The Rec. Dept. submitted its budget already for FY2022‐23. Meeting to review the budget are expected in
Feb./Mar. 2022.
Old Business
ARPA update
ARPA funding and project plans for the Rec. Dept. were reviewed by Cheryl. Cheryl stated she made more requests for the
next phase of funding that Norwich is getting in May 2022.
Julie Cagle asked about the status of the Aquatic Center. Cheryl stated she submitted the request in her ARPA proposal that
was due in October. Julie stated she was on the committee to bring a community center or aquatic center to Norwich years
ago and would love to see this finally happen. She stated that New London has more recreation facilities than Norwich and
they are getting a Recreation Center and she would like to see this for Norwich too as we have a larger population. The idea
for the aquatic center is 2 pools; one for therapeutic needs and swim lessons and one for competitive swimming (especially
high school and AAU meets). Cheryl has experience as an aquatic director.
Derrell mentioned that a School Building committee was formed by the City and a pool could be added there. Chery asked if
herself or Tara could be on that committee to give input.
Other Business
Jeff Blinderman announced his resignation from the Board. He wished us well and stated he enjoyed his time serving as
Chairman.
Meeting adjourned at 7:05pm.
